To renew a real estate license in Kentucky, the completion of six hours of continuing education is required. This requirement ensures that real estate professionals stay updated on current laws, regulations, and best practices in the field. It aims to enhance the knowledge and skills of licensees, which ultimately serves to protect the interests of consumers and maintain professionalism within the industry.

The continuing education hours must be completed during the licensing period, and failure to do so would result in the inability to renew the license.
